I updated the pages here on PPGSM, but they didn't change so much from 2008... Rates are very expensive if you use the scratch cards top-up, while if you use internet based tariffs they are much cheaper. I think any operator could be fine, they all have quite similar rates.
|
- The validity is (usually) one year.
- Some discount offers like CBB do have a no-use-fee. - All cards using the Sonofon / Telenor Dk network are not roaming. The customer care (from Telenor Dk) will not help you recharging when outside Danemark - For "3" you have to have a CPR number to get a prepaid SIM. - Telia usually may be recharged with foreign (no-danish) credit cards via the Internet |
Ok, thanks guys. This CBB actually looks good but the only problem is that if you do not spend at least 30 DKK (4 EURO) during 2 months they will charge you 17 DKK (8,5 DKK for each month) so if not used, card can go blank pretty fast. But still, they look like the best choice for me..
